> Ever since I've owned a mac, I've noticed that when I enter text into a 
> single line edit box on a web form e.g. a username or password field, the 
> first character I type doesn't always get entered.  To use a password field 
> as an example, VO will click for each character, even though the first one 
> hasn't registered.
> This happens with both Webkit and Safari.
> Also, there are times where vO doesn't make any sound when entering a 
> password even though I haven't muted it's sounds.
> 
> does anyone else have this problem and if so, is there a work around?  Or is 
> it one of those things that'll hopefully be fixed in 10.6.3?
